What a cozy hidden gem! Manu & Loyd have a wonderfully intimate restaurant, my partner & I felt transported to some generations-old family restaurant in the european countryside. Working our way through a tasting menu, each course managed to wow us in different ways! All of the dishes were masterfully presented, even before taking any bites we knew we were in for something special. The menu explored various seafood dishes through a myriad of expressions: spiced oysters to refreshing ceviche to rich, buttery crab! Alongside we had pairings of non-alcoholic cocktails, since my partner & I are currently on a sobriety break. This was by no means a compromise on full flavour! Gargamelle was a delightful experience. The room itself is thoughtfully decorated, feeling cozy & welcoming. The drinks kept us searching for the bottoms of the glasses. The food is of course the star of the show, delighting at every turn... To anyone looking for the perfect restaurant for date night in the Old Port, look no further!

Overall the restaurant was fairly good. However, I won't recommend the 3 Courses tasting menu that was promoted on the social media. We didn't know what was included in the tasting menu, so we had a high expectation for it. We started with the soup which was pretty blend. The garlic leaves took over the flavor of soup. The oyster was good. Love the Yuzu mousse & the chili on top. This one is a great combination. However, one of our oyster was bad. The main course was a chow mein with peanut butter sauce & chili oil. This is a very common house dish in my culture so it was a little bit disappointing to have it as the main. I would say the chili oil was quite authentic. The egg yolk added extra creaminess to the sauce. The final dish was three arancini balls. The flavor was fine with some braised beef cheeks in it. This tasting menu was quite confusing. Per website, the order should be an amuse-bouche, starter & main. Based on the order of the food brought to us, I wasn't sure if the chow-mein or the arancini is the main. I would prefer that they remove one of two dish & include a dessert to it. Also maybe include a big more protein & vegetables as the meal is probably 80% carbs. The cocktails are around $20 per drinks. The atmosphere was nice with the music & the decor. The owner/ chef is very enthusiastic & has nice personalities. The waitress is also very sweet. Overall, I won't recommend the tasting menu we had. Maybe it would be nicer to order a la carte. If you love the open to talk atmosphere & have some drinks. I will recommend this restaurant.
